Ingredients

  • 1 lb ground turkey
  • 1 tablespoon minced fresh ginger
  • 2 teaspoons minced garlic
  • 1 teaspoon finely minced fresh sage
  • 1 teaspoon finely minced fresh thyme
  • 12 teaspoon salt (or more to taste)
  • 14 teaspoon fresh ground black pepper (or more to taste, I prefer a little more)
  • 4 hamburger buns, split and toasted

Method

  • Depending upon your cooking source preference: Preheat broiler and coat a broiler pan with cooking spray, or get your grill up to your heat standards.
  • In a large bowl, combine turkey, ginger, garlic, sage, thyme, salt and pepper.
  • Shape mixture into 4 patties.
  • Place on prepared broiler pan and broil 4 inches from heat about 6 minutes, or cook on your outdoor grill.
  • Flip and broil or grill 5-6 minutes more, or until centers are no longer pink.
  • Serve burgers on buns with any fixings you like.
